Where does the word cuticle come from?

cuticle (n.)

1610s, “outer layer of the skin, epidermis,” from Latin cuticula, diminutive of cutis “skin,” from PIE root *(s)keu- “to cover, conceal” (source also of hide (n. 1)).

What are Earthworm cuticles?

The collagenous cuticle of annelids overlies the epidermis and, together with it, lines the gut, private parts and excretory openings to various degrees, and also the chaetal follicles in polychaetes and oligochaetes. The cuticle is perforated by openings from the epidermal gland cells and by sense cells (see Chap. 17).

What is the white part under your fingernail?

The lunula is the white crescent-shaped area at the base of a nail. The lunula, or lunulae (pl.) (from Latin ‘little moon’), is the crescent-shaped whitish area of the bed of a fingernail or toenail.

Are cuticles bad?

Dermatologists say there’s no good reason to cut the cuticles. Cutting them could open the door to infection or irritation. “If you remove the cuticle, that space is wide open, and anything can get in there,” Scher says. Cutting your cuticles can also lead to nail problems, such as ridges, white spots, or white lines.

What is a Russian manicure?

A Russian manicure is a technique that uses an electronic file to gently remove the excess skin and deceased cuticle around your nail bed. … Using an electronic file, the Russian manicure technique allows your nail technician much more precision in how much and how carefully excess skin is removed.

What do blue nails mean?

Blue fingernails are caused by a low level or lack of oxygen circulating in your red blood cells. This condition is known as cyanosis. It occurs when there isn’t enough oxygen in your blood, making the skin or membrane below the skin turn a purplish-blue color.

What is dip powder nails?

Also commonly referred to as SNS nails, the dip powder nail technique involves dipping the nail into colored powder (or brushing the dip powder onto the nail), then using a clear sealant on top. The result is a longer-lasting manicure that can remain chip-free for up to a month.
